God had told Joseph that he would be a great ruler. Unfortunately, he shared this with his brothers and father opening the door to Satan to try and thwart God's plan. Out of jealousy and hatred, Joseph's brothers sold him into slavery. Joseph's first master in Egypt appointed him over all his household, but Satan used his master's wife to get him thrown into prison on a false accusation. Throughout this whole ordeal, Joseph never lost sight of the vision and the promise God had given him. In due time, God did in fact exalt him to become the #2 man in all of Egypt - one of the greatest countries of that time.

 

This Animal Parable is the story of a cat named Echo who befriended Joseph in prison. She learns that when you give God your best, it opens the door for Him to give His best to you. You can read the real story of Joseph in your Bible at Genesis 37-50.

 

 

Echo In Egypt – Key Concepts

A Parable About Giving God Your Best

 

1. Echo means to imitate or repeat. This is exactly what God desires for you. Study God's Word. Act like Him and speak like Him. When you start walking by faith and with God's love in your heart, nothing can stop you from living a long and victorious life full of joy!

Joshua 1:8  John 14:23-24  Ephesians 5:1-2  1 Peter 2:21-24

 

2. God had given Joseph a vision of his future as ruler over his brothers. Instead of quietly praising God, he boasted to his family about what God had revealed to him. His youthful pride was fuel to the fire of the jealousy and envy that was already simmering among his brothers. Certainly God was able to elevate Joseph to rule over Egypt without him having to be sold as a slave, or thrown into prison on a false charge. But strife within Joseph's family opened the door for Satan to come in and try to mess it all up. In the end, Joseph's faithfulness allowed God to put him charge in spite of all Satan's traps and tricks. As God reveals His plan for you, it may be a smart thing not to start telling the world. That may open the door to strife and allow Satan to delay all that is planned for you. Be humble and at peace with everyone, especially your family. Be quick to forgive and love everyone. This will make it all the more easier for God to put you in the place He has planned for you.

Psalm 37:1-11  Matthew 6:14-15  James 3:13-18

 

3. Echo prayed for a home and believed she had it! In fact, she did have it in the spiritual world, it just hadn't manifested in the natural world yet. Instead of waiting patiently for the home, the cares of the world distracted her. There was so much abundance she forgot all about her prayer. The minute Echo prayed in faith, the angels were working on bringing her and Joseph together. And then preparing Joseph to be promoted. If Echo hadn't forgot about God, she could have been living with Joseph many years earlier. When you pray, you must believe that you have whatever you asked for in prayer. That is faith! But you also must exercise patience. It may take a little time for it to manifest in your life. But it absolutely will, if you refuse to give up!

Matthew 7:7-11  21:18-22  Mark 11:22-24  John 14:13-14  16:23-24  James 1:2-8

 

4. Joseph's patient faith paid off in a big way. Whatever situation he was thrown into, God's favor surrounded him and he was promoted. When he had the opportunity to go before Pharaoh, he gave all the credit to God. Pharaoh saw and heard God's wisdom through Joseph and immediately knew that he was the only man capable of saving Egypt from the coming famine. Pharaoh promoted Joseph and fulfilled God's promise that he would be a great ruler. God's favor and wisdom belongs to you, if you have made Jesus the Lord of your life. Start studying God's Word and confess it night and day. God's wisdom will open doors and lead to promotion and success at everything you do. Remember, the greatest human wisdom is foolishness in God's eyes and the weakness of God is still many times stronger than men.

Proverbs 3:13-26  4:5-13  Matthew 7:24-25  1 Corinthians 1:19-31  Colossians 3:12-17

 

5. During the years of plenty, Echo had all she needed. But when the famine started things weren't so easy. She should have been talking to God all along, but she didn't. When she finally remembered God, He was ready and waiting with a plan to take care of all her needs. God is a jealous God. He wants to be your total source and supply because He loves you and understands exactly what will bring joy, peace and success to your life. Start today thanking God and telling Him how much you love Him. Seek His wisdom and build your faith. You will be overwhelmed by God's loving care. People will be amazed at all the peace, prosperity and joy that will be yours and beg you to tell them about God.

Exodus 20:1-6  Deuteronomy 28:1-14  Job 36:11  Psalm 23:1-6  Matthew 6:25-34

 

6. God asked Echo to give the fish she had just caught to someone else. This was her only food and she was hungry. But God had an even greater purpose for the request. He was going to use Echo's gift to feed others and then turn around and give Echo a family and a home. That fish would have fed Echo for a day or two. God was going to provide her food that would last a lifetime. God wasn't after Echo's last, but her best, so He could release His best for her. In the world, it seems better to get things than to give things. But in the Kingdom of God, it is just the opposite. It is much more profitable to give, because when you give as God directs, it opens the door for God to give to you. And when God gives, it is many, many times greater than anything you could ever imagine.

Proverbs 3:9-10  28:27  Malachi 3:10-12  Luke 6:38  Acts 20:35
